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72 101 78888771 897515836 7603426700
334928 33662205
334928 33662205
731127307 94 20644 8842
All about undefined
Interested in learning more?
334928 33662205
731127307 94 20644 8842
See more
43020521 84571231799
09 71463067 4218810198
See more
26 653385866
77188 8003 97
See more